    I accidently moved the tools docker. It was on the right of my screen with the actual right border/scroll bar of the doc to the left of the tools docker. I did something and it (docker) got really small then I tried to enlarge it by dragging a corner and then it got across the top of my document full screen horizontally. It really takes up a lot of room this way and cuts down the view size of the doc. How can I return it to the original position? CorelDraw 9.337 Win 98SE

    Don't panic. Click/hold down on the dockers tab and drag it to the far right and release. You'll notice as you drag it to the right (or even left)the size will change. If you've got other dockers, align the Obj docker to the rest of the group and release.

    I've seen that on mine also. I wish I could recall the exact steps I took to get rid of it. I suggest you completely close all dockers. Restart Draw holding down f8 and check yes to default. If you have a customized workspace, make a backup copy first to reinstall later.

    Once you have the default workspace, use Windows/Dockers to open the Object Manager docker. It should open on the right with a full window. Be sure to unexpand it before opening the next docker. Let me know if this works.
